BUG: Tether Parameters of Clothing useless

Hello there,
I’ve just noticed that the Tether Parameters (Tether Limit and Tether Stiffness) seem to be useless because it seems like they are not affecting the Clothing behavior at all. I would suppose that this is a bug because the Parameters are simply not working.

Steps to Reproduce:

  1. Open up a Skeletal Mesh and add a clothing section with the in-engine tools or import an apex cloth asset or use an existing mesh with clothing sections
  2. Change the Tether Parameters like you want and watch if the cloth behaves differently with different values
    → clothing behavior doesn’t change

Any comment on that? It’s probably also connected to the more stretchy cloth behavior since the introduction on NvCloth.

UPDATE: I’ve played a bit and compared the Clothing Behavior of 4.14 and 4.17 and the clothing in 4.17 behaves mostly like the 4.14 Clothing with Tether Limit set to 2.0 permanently. This might only be an UI Bug or something that simply causes the clothing API to ignore the Tether Parameters.
